




I spent a week putting the 16000mAh Rechargeable Cordless Electric Lunch Box to the test during various outdoor excursions and office days. It promises a fully mobile heating solution, and I wanted to see if the battery life and heating consistency held up to real-world demands.
The unit features a robust construction with a removable stainless-steel inner container that feels durable and easy to sanitize. The heating element is surprisingly efficient, warming food evenly without drying it out, which is a common pitfall for portable warmers.
Using the built-in timer was the highlight of the experience, as it allowed me to schedule my heating so my lunch was ready exactly when I finished my hike. The operation is intuitive, though the device is slightly bulkier than a standard lunch container due to the large battery pack.
This is an excellent tool for backcountry campers or professionals who frequently work in vehicles and want to avoid relying on fast food.
Overall, this product earns a solid 4 out of 5 for its innovative approach to off-grid dining. While the $129.00 price tag is an investment, the convenience of having a hot meal anywhere makes it a worthwhile addition for the right user.
